Cellular Automata Simulation Of Urban Land Use Change Based On Random Forest

Building a land use model to simulate the process,pattern and mechanism of land use change is the focus of academic and industrial circles.Based on the research object of Jinan Central District,taking land use,DEM,road,population and economy as the data source,this paper obtains the land use change information of the research area from the angle of time,land use transfer,landscape pattern.Under the natural development scenario model,RF-CA-Markov and LR-CA-Markov models were used to simulate the land use evolution process and predict the spatial distribution pattern of land use in 2025.The main research work and conclusions of this thesis are as follows.(1)In this paper,the Landsat image data of the study area in 2005,2010,2015 and2020 were collected,and the image preprocessing such as radiometric correction,projection and cropping were carried out.The random forest method was used for image classification,and the multi-temporal land use status data of five land types,such as construction land,cultivated land,forest land and water area,are obtained.(2)The temporal and spatial changes of land use in the study area from 2005 to 2020 were analyzed from the perspectives of time,land use transfer and landscape pattern,etc.(1)From the perspective of time,the trend of land use change in the study area was the continuous increase of construction land,while other land use types fluctuated in a larger range.(2)The transfer matrix of land use was used to calculate the transfer direction of each land use type.The change of land use structure was obvious,mainly from construction land,cultivated land and forest land.(3)The landscape single index and landscape level index directly reflect the land use situation of the study area.The results of single index show that the construction land is dominant,the spatial agglomeration is increasing,the fragmentation degree of patch is decreasing,and the relationship with other land types is increasing.The proportion of cultivated land is declining,and the degree of fragmentation was deepening constantly.The fragmentation of forest land and water area is increasing,and the spatial connectivity is decreasing.The proportion of other land use types in the landscape pattern declined.The landscape continuity of urban land decreased,the degree of fragmentation and the complexity of spatial structure increased,the landscape structure maintained a good diversity,and the distribution of patch types was relatively uniform.(3)The RF-CA-Markov model was constructed to simulate the land use evolution process of the study area during 2010-2015 and 2015-2020,and the land use simulation maps of 2015 and 2020 were obtained,which had a high consistency with the current situation maps of 2015 and 2020.In order to improve the reliability of the simulation results,the LR-CA-Markov model was selected for comparison and verification.The experiment show that compared with LR-CA-Markov model,RF-CA-Markov model was more suitable to predict the future land use pattern,and the land use pattern in the study area from 2020 to 2025 will keep the development trend from 2015 to 2020.
